He's Dan is a 13 year old bay gelding. He's Dan is trained by A A Meikle, at Pukeatua and owned by A A & Ms C R Meikle.
He's Dan’s last race event was at 02/08/2020 and it has not been nominated for any upcoming race.
Career form is 9 wins, 10 seconds, 4 thirds from 75 starts with a lifetime career prize money of $142,825.
With a 12% Win Percentage and 31% Place Percentage. He's Dan's last race event was at Te Aroha.
Exposed form for its last starts is 0-4-1-7-8.
